What’s Included in Our Flat Removals Service

Items Typically Included

  • Household furniture – beds, wardrobes, sofas, tables, chairs
  • White goods – fridges, freezers, washing machines (subject to access)
  • Electronics – TVs, computers, sound systems
  • Personal belongings – clothes, books, ornaments, kitchenware
  • Boxed items and storage crates
  • Outdoor/balcony items – small furniture, plants, bikes

Items We Normally Exclude

To protect your belongings and our team, some items are excluded or require prior agreement:

  • Hazardous materials – paints, chemicals, fuel, gas bottles
  • Illegal or controlled items
  • Extremely valuable items (e.g. high-value jewellery, cash, rare collections) – best carried personally
  • Very heavy or specialist items (e.g. grand pianos, safes) without prior notice
  • Animals or live plants in bulk – these usually require specialist transport

If you have unusual or bulky items, let us know in advance. In many cases we can accommodate them with the right planning and equipment.

Our Flat Removals Process

1. Enquiry & Quote

You contact Man with Van Wapping by phone or online with basic details: current address, destination, size of property and preferred move date. We ask a few practical questions about access, parking and lifts. Based on this, we give an initial, no-obligation quote and outline the likely schedule.

2. Survey – Virtual or Onsite

For most flat moves, we carry out a short virtual survey (video call or photos) to confirm volumes, access and any special items. For larger or more complex flats, we may visit in person in Wapping. This step lets us allocate the right team, vehicle and protective materials and helps avoid surprises on move day.

3. Packing & Preparation

You can choose between:

  • Packing service – our trained movers pack your belongings using quality materials, protecting fragile items, TVs and pictures.
  • Part-packing – we pack only delicate or awkward items, you handle the rest.
  • Self-packing – you pack everything, and we supply boxes and materials if requested.

On the day, we protect floors, doors and lifts as required by your building, using blankets, covers and trolleys suitable for flat moves.

4. Loading & Transport

We position the vehicle as close as possible within Wapping parking rules, then carefully load your items in a logical order. Furniture is wrapped or blanketed, and fragile boxes are secured. Our professional drivers then transport your belongings directly to the new property, using the safest and most efficient route.

5. Unloading & Placement

At your new flat, we unload room by room, placing items where you want them. We reassemble basic furniture we dismantled, and we ensure communal areas and lifts are left clean and undamaged. Before we leave, we ask you to check that everything is in the correct place and nothing is missing.

Transparent Flat Removals Pricing in Wapping

We believe in clear, upfront pricing with no hidden extras. Our quotes are based on:

  • Property size and volume of belongings
  • Distance between addresses
  • Access challenges – stairs, lifts, long carries, parking
  • Number of movers required
  • Additional services – packing, materials, storage, furniture assembly

We usually offer either a fixed price for the whole job or an hourly rate for smaller or more flexible moves. Any potential additional costs, such as congestion charges or extended waiting times due to key delays, are explained before you book so you can make a clear decision.

Frequently Asked Questions

How much does a flat removal in Wapping cost?

The cost of a flat removal in Wapping depends on the size of your property, the volume of belongings, access conditions and the distance to your new home. Smaller studio or one-bedroom flat moves may be charged on an hourly basis, while larger or more complex moves are usually priced as a fixed quote. Additional services such as packing, materials or storage will also affect the total. Once we’ve carried out a quick survey, we provide a clear, itemised price so you know exactly what’s included before you book.

Can you handle same-day or urgent flat moves?

Yes, in many cases we can accommodate same-day or urgent flat removals in Wapping, depending on our schedule and the scale of the move. If you need to move quickly due to last-minute tenancy changes or completion timings, contact us as early as you can with full details. We’ll assess what’s realistic, advise on the most efficient approach and confirm costs upfront. While availability can be limited at very short notice, we will always do our best to offer a practical, professional solution.

Are my belongings insured during the move?

Your belongings are covered by our goods in transit insurance while they are being moved in our vehicles, subject to policy terms and conditions. We also hold public liability insurance, which covers accidental damage to third-party property such as communal areas in your block. We’ll explain the key points of cover when you book and can provide documentation if required by your building management. For particularly high-value or delicate items, we may recommend additional precautions or specialist handling for extra peace of mind.

What’s included in your flat removals service?

Our standard flat removals service includes loading, transport and unloading of your agreed household items between addresses. We protect furniture with blankets, handle boxes and general belongings, and place items in the correct rooms at your new flat. Optional extras include full or part packing services, supply of packing materials, dismantling and reassembly of basic furniture and short-term storage. We’ll confirm exactly what is and isn’t included in your quote so you can tailor the service to your needs and budget.

How is your service different from a basic man-and-van?

While we offer flexible, van-based moves, our approach goes beyond a casual man-and-van. We provide trained teams, careful planning, appropriate equipment and full insurance cover. We assess access, parking and building rules in advance, bring sufficient staff for safe lifting and ensure your belongings are protected and secured in transit. With an informal man-and-van, you may not receive this level of planning or protection, and insurance is often limited or non-existent. Our aim is to deliver a reliable, accountable and stress-free moving experience.

How far in advance should I book my flat removal?

Ideally, you should book your flat removal in Wapping 2–4 weeks in advance, especially if you’re moving at the end of the month or on a weekend, when demand is highest. Early booking gives you the widest choice of dates and allows us to plan around building access times, lift bookings and parking arrangements. However, we understand that completion dates and tenancy agreements can change, so we always try to accommodate shorter notice where possible. The sooner you contact us, the more options we’ll have.
